Air Fryer Baking: What You Need to Know

Your air fryer isn’t just for crispy fries — it’s a **mini convection oven** perfect for baking.

Best For:

  • Mug cakes
  • Cookie batches (6–8)
  • Mini pies and tarts
  • Cornbread, muffins, and small cakes

Pro Tips:

  1. Preheat: 3 minutes at baking temp for even rise.
  2. Use the right pan: Ramekins, mugs, or silicone molds.
  3. Don’t overcrowd: Leave space for air circulation.
  4. Check early: Air fryers cook faster than ovens.
  5. Lower the temp: Bake at 320–360°F (20°F below oven temp).

Recipe 1: Single-Serve Chocolate Mug Cake

Servings: 1 | Protein: 5g | Prep: 5 mins | Cook: 8 mins | Cost: $1.20/serving

Appliance: Air Fryer

Ingredients:

  • 4 tbsp flour
  • 3 tbsp sugar
  • 2 tbsp cocoa powder
  • ¼ tsp baking powder
  • 3 tbsp milk
  • 2 tbsp oil
  • 1 tbsp chocolate chips

Step-by-Step Instructions:

  1. Mix dry ingredients in a microwave-safe mug.
  2. Add milk and oil, stir into a smooth batter.
  3. Top with chocolate chips.
  4. Air fry at 350°F for 6–8 minutes.
  5. Let cool 2 minutes, then enjoy!

Recipe 2: Chewy Air Fryer Chocolate Chip Cookies

Servings: 8 cookies | Protein: 3g | Prep: 10 mins | Cook: 10 mins | Cost: $0.90/serving

Appliance: Air Fryer

Ingredients:

  • ½ cup butter, softened
  • ½ cup brown sugar
  • ¼ cup white s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 1¼ cups flour
  • ½ tsp baking soda
  • ½ tsp salt
  • 1 cup chocolate chips

Step-by-Step Instructions:

  1. Cream butter and sugars. Mix in egg and vanilla.
  2. Stir in flour, baking soda, and salt.
  3. Fold in chocolate chips.
  4. Form 8 balls, place in air fryer basket (leave space).
  5. Air fry at 320°F for 8–10 minutes.
  6. Cool 5 minutes before eating.

Recipe 3: Mini Apple Pie in a Jar

Servings: 4 | Protein: 4g | Prep: 15 mins | Cook: 15 mins | Cost: $1.50/serving

Appliance: Air Fryer

Ingredients:

  • 4 store-bought pie crusts
  • 2 cups diced apples
  • ¼ cup sugar
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1 tbsp butter
  • ¼ cup water

Step-by-Step Instructions:

  1. Cut crusts into circles. Press into 4 ramekins or heat-safe jars.
  2. Mix apples, sugar, cinnamon. Fill crusts.
  3. Top with second crust circle, crimp edges, vent with knife.
  4. Place in air fryer, add 1–2 tbsp water to bottom to prevent drying.
  5. Air fry at 350°F for 12–15 minutes until golden.
  6. Serve warm with ice cream.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can you really bake in an air fryer?

Yes! While not identical to an oven, the air fryer's convection heat is perfect for small-batch baking like mug cakes, cookies, and mini pies. It's faster and uses less energy than heating a full oven.

What temperature should I bake at in the air fryer?

For baking, use 320°F–360°F. Start 20°F lower than your oven recipe and check early. Most baked goods take 8–15 minutes.

What pans can I use in the air fryer for baking?

Use oven-safe ramekins, mugs, silicone molds, or small metal pans that fit in your basket. Always check your air fryer manual for clearance and safety.

Do I need to preheat the air fryer for baking?

Yes, preheating for 3 minutes helps create even heat for better rise and browning, just like an oven.
